Furthermore, the conolidine molecule didn't communicate with the classical receptors, which means that it wouldn't contend against opioid peptides to bind to these receptors.

"We confirmed that conolidine binds towards the freshly recognized opioid receptor ACKR3, while showing no affinity for another 4 classical opioid receptors. By doing so, conolidine blocks ACKR3 and prevents it from trapping the In a natural way secreted opioids, which in turn boosts their availability for interacting with click here classical receptors.
